The Census is a count of everyone residing in the United States, conducted every ten years. With only 10 questions, the 2010 Census questionnaire takes approximately 10 minutes to complete. The 2010 Census is important for three reasons:
The data collected by the U.S. Census Bureau is confidential. This data is used to produce statistics. Your answers cannot be used against you by any government agency or court. The confidentiality of all your information is protected by the U.S. Code (Title 13) and violating this law is a crime with severe penalties. In addition, other federal laws, including the Confidential Statistical Efficiency Act and the Privacy Act reinforce these protections.
